Eating and sleeping one experienced Parent recommends always travelling on a Ful stomach for everyone is happier when a Well fed. We carry a variety of snacks treat during the Day for breakfast and in a Pinch tide us Over at night. Not Only is it More convenient and less expensive than eating out every meal you Are also More Likely to find something that finicky Young Hafets actually like. 1 there Are few things that cause More problems when travelling than eating out. 1 Seldom does our family of four want Sci Eal t y the same thing at the same time. We try to Trade off by eating what the children want sometimes and eating what the adults i a want at other times. On occasion we be found that if we let the kids eat burgers and Fries at a fast food place they will then a sit quietly nursing a soft drink and colouring while we enjoy a meal at a real a restaurant. A keep in mind that the wait to be served can be very Long in european restaurants. We always take workbooks and pads for 1 i the children to use while waiting for food. Not Only does it Cut Down on the fighting a a but in also creates a Good Opportunity for parents and children to do something _ together. R finding a place to spend the night is \ another Challenge. Hotels inns and private Homes have far fewer rooms for families than for couples so it is Wise to Start looking Early for a room especially during Peak vat action seasons. We have been pleased with i he room finding services at. Tourist offices and Railroad stations a especially the ones that Are willing to make recommendations. Tell them about it to help children gel. The most out of travel give then As much knowledge As possible about the destination Belore you rigid Cortright director of Catholic University of America s children education Center in Washington d.c., advises parents to Tell children where they re going what they la see and How Long they la be gone. ,. She recommends telling them what to expect when travelling by Public. Transportation and a that different foods will be available in restaurants. She advises coaching them on How to talk with new people shake hands and introduce themselves. Try teaching them a Quot few foreign words a Quot please Quot and Quot thank you Quot Are a Good Start _ Cort right also suggests telling them what to look for at museums and to move them through quickly even Young children will enjoy museums if they Aren t expected to linger at each exhibit one effective idea is to buy a few a postcards at a museum gift shop and then head for the galleries where the pictured items Are Likely to be fount the children c an search Tor the items while the parents steal a Little extra viewing Lime. It May be hard to read to children about destinations but they la probably be quite willing to watch videos and movies. The sound of music is a Good introduction to Austria Heidi for Switzerland and Hans Christian Andersen for Denmark. Kids can learn something while being entertained by a Good Story. In addition Many military Community libraries have videos about different countries that can be checked out.
